    Bill, hands down the best set up I have found is a Big Dog Steel AICS bipod adapter with the Harris screw and a Sinclair Tactical Bipod for shooting FPR and F Class. Solid as a rock.
    As for tactical matches, may be a bit heavy/bulky though.
    I do have 2 set ups like this if you want to come to a match for a test ride.
